随笔分类 -  C/C++

摘要:c/c++中经常会涉及到获取内置数据类型(int,float,double)的极大值或极小值,结合STL的numeric_limits可以很轻松地实现,实际上c语言也自带了一些极值的宏。下面分别介绍通过STL的numeric_limits获取极值和通过c语言的头文件的宏获取极值的方法。1.STL的numeric_limits方法numeric_limits是STL中表示内置数据类型的算术性质的模板类。(MSDN:The template class describes arithmetic properties of built-in numerical types。)这里只介绍获取极值的方法 阅读全文

posted @ 2011-11-30 00:15 Edward298 阅读(942) 评论(0) 推荐(0) |

摘要:win32中winmain参数lpCmdLine是地址名是无法正常运行首先描述准备显示的功能:使用win32 app创建一个程序,可以实现文件关联方面的操作,即选择一副图片,可以使用右键选择此次得到的exe(类似于文件文件关联)。但是程序没有正常运行,于是使用messagebox调出lpcmdline,弹出如下对话框:于是,认为lpcmdline中存在单斜杠(/),但是被被函数调用 ,这个单斜杠成为了转义字符。实际上,这种想法是错误的,因为lpcmdline的类型Lpstr就是char *,因此如果char数组那个存在单斜杠,那么字符中一定是’//’。其实真正的问题,在于那个引号!!!笔者在w 阅读全文

posted @ 2010-12-27 09:21 Edward298 阅读(298) 评论(0) 推荐(0) |

博客园  ©  2004-2026
浙公网安备 33010602011771号 浙ICP备2021040463号-3